MBA in Rural Management
The MBA in Rural Management learning track is designed to equip and prepare students to manage businesses and development programs that meet the needs of rural India. The courses offered in this segmnet include rural marketing, agribusiness management, microfinance, management of cooperatives and FPOs, and management of rural development. The distance learning MBA in Rural Management is most suitable for sales professionals in FMCG, Rural sales, Agri- inputs, NGOs, banks, and government initiatives. Rural Management graduates work in India as agribusiness executives, microfinance specialists, rural marketing managers, and managers of development programs.
